Output 38a654fa222efa2f16b18c961e78491f92b6d7c3c1a7ee288955a18e76c55ec6:3

value
45616719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5b11dfa14cfe24a9c9346432d87f3b40aee7f1 OP_EQUAL
address
3HK4ZzJBD2crrdevyanH2isa5vfGhue2vN
transaction
38a654fa222efa2f16b18c961e78491f92b6d7c3c1a7ee288955a18e76c55ec6
confirmations
287387
spent
true